一种直接用于PCR的土壤微生物DNA提取方法

摘要: 以橡胶林土壤为材料,直接提取土壤微生物DNA。研究表明,本实验介绍的方法不仅可以获得大片段,并且不需要纯化即可直接用于PCR扩增和DNA酶切等后续操作,每克土壤DNA提取量约为2.1~4.6μg。此方法操作简单、快捷、为土壤宏基因组文库的构建和土壤微生物群落结构的多样性分析提供基础。

Abstract: In this paper we test with soil microorganisms from Hevea forest, and direct extract microbial nucleic acid from soil, The research shows that this method of introduction in this experiment not only generate the largest DNA fragments in size, but also it was directly used as PCR amplification and digestion of restriction enzymes and later operation without purification, about 2.1-4.6μg DNA yields could be extracted from one gram soil on average. This method is easy and quickly in operation, and provide the basis of the construction of metagenomic library and diversity analysis of soil microbial communities.
